While the process of tarnishing a deck is simple sufficient as a do it yourself task, it does call for something that's at a premium for lots of homeowners: time. Due to the fact that of the drying out process, staining can take days to finish from beginning to end up, even if the real active time entailed is closer to 35 hours.

A conventional 500-square-foot deck, for instance, should take no greater than 35 hours complete to clean and tarnish. Keep in mind, however, that added tasks such as fixing boards, removing old paint or reinforcing structures will contribute to the moment and material prices of any type of professional deck discoloration job. As their name shows, oil-based stains require a mineral spirit or paint thinner to tidy up, whereas water-based spots are those you can clean up with water alone. Nevertheless, there's likewise a distinction in their application and results. As a whole, oil-based discolorations are considered to be a much better aesthetic choice since they're made from all-natural materials that permeate deeper into the wood, drawing out its natural grain and leaving a richer, extra all-natural coating.
